The Honda City has long been a favorite in India, known for its reliability, comfort, and premium feel. For 2025, expectations are high for improvements that will solidify its position as a leading sedan in the competitive Indian market. Honda is likely focusing on refining the City’s design, enhancing its interior, and improving overall build quality. Expect subtle design tweaks that sharpen its elegant aesthetic, perhaps with updated lighting elements, a redesigned grille, and more premium exterior finishes. The interior is likely to see significant improvements, with enhanced materials, a more spacious and ergonomic layout, and a larger touchscreen infotainment system.

Powertrain Advancements

Under the hood, the Honda City 2025 is expected to see advancements in its powertrain options, with a focus on efficiency and performance. For the Indian market, a strong emphasis on fuel efficiency and reduced emissions is likely. Expect refinements to the existing petrol and hybrid engine options, alongside the potential introduction of mild-hybrid or plug-in hybrid powertrains. These advancements will aim to provide a smoother and more responsive driving experience, while also reducing the environmental impact. The focus will be on delivering a balanced performance that’s both powerful and efficient, suitable for daily commutes and long-distance travel with the family.

Tech and Features

In today’s tech-driven world, sedans are expected to offer a wide range of modern features. The Honda City 2025 is likely to come with an enhanced infotainment system, providing drivers and passengers with a more connected and intuitive experience. Expect features like wireless smartphone connectivity, a larger touchscreen display, a premium sound system, and a head-up display. Safety features will also be a priority, with perhaps the inclusion of advanced driver-assistance systems (ADAS), such as adaptive cruise control, lane departure warning, automatic emergency braking, and a 360-degree camera system.

The Indian Context

For any sedan to succeed in India, it needs to strike a balance between performance, features, and affordability. Honda understands this well. They’ll likely be working to keep the price competitive, ensuring the City remains accessible to a wide range of Indian buyers. Reliability is also a key factor. Indian consumers demand cars that can withstand the rigors of daily use, and Honda has a reputation for building robust vehicles. The 2025 City will need to uphold this reputation, offering a dependable ride that’s built to last. Honda’s network of service centers across India will also play a crucial role in providing accessible maintenance and support. The Indian consumer wants a reliable and value-packed sedan.
